Dark Blue

The color #151629 is a dark blue that can be used in various design contexts. This color has RGB values of 21, 22, 41 and HSL values of 237°, 32%, 12%.

Complementary Colors for #151629

The complementary color for #151629 is #282715. These colors sit opposite each other on the color wheel and create a striking visual contrast when used together.

Analogous Colors for #151629

The analogous colors for #151629 are #152028 and #1E1528. These three colors sit next to each other on the color wheel, creating a natural and harmonious color combination.

Triadic Colors for #151629

The triadic colors for #151629 are #281516 and #162815. These three colors are evenly spaced around the color wheel, offering a vibrant and balanced color combination.
